So I got a joystick and it works great with air, but I would also like to be able to control a tank turret with it and that's the problem. There is no setting that allows me to use the joystick in place of the mouse for land vehicles so I was wondering if there was any way.

To make your joystick to move the cursor and thus controlling e.g. tank turret, you have to edit controls.con file manually and add 2 lines of code into it.

Code: Select all

ControlMap.addAxisToAxisMapping c_PIMouseLookX IDFGameController_1 IDAxis_0 0 1
ControlMap.addAxisToAxisMapping c_PIMouseLookY IDFGameController_1 IDAxis_1 1 1
These lines have to be added into "ControlMap.create defaultPlayerInputControlMap" section of the file.

Values of "IDFGameController_X" and "IDAxis_X Y" depend on your game controller count and axis directions, respectively. You probably have to find correct values by trial and error. Values are zero based, so if you have only one game controller, the correct value for controller is "IDFGameController_0".
